Mint Chocolate Chip Cookie Bars

Ingredients

  • 1 cup butter
  • 1½ cups white s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la
  • 1 3/4 cups flour
  • 1/4 cup dutch processed c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 1/2 cup chocolate mint baking chips or chopped chocolate mint bars

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• In a large stand mixer, cream together the butter and sugar for 2-3 minutes.
  • Add the eggs and vanilla and mix well.
  • Add the flour, cocoa powder, baking soda and salt and mix until just combined. Remove the batter from the mixer and stir in the chips by hand.
  • Line a 9x13 baking pan with parchment paper and spread the batter evenly into the pan. Place the baking pan into the oven and bake for 30-35 minutes.
  • After 35 minutes, remove the pan from the oven and let cool to room temperature. Once slightly cooled, transfer the baking pan to the fridge and chill for 1 hour before slicing and serving.
